exoerythrocytic

/ˌɛksoʊəˌrɪθrəˈsaɪtɪk/
adjective
  1. Relating to the stage of a malaria parasite's life cycle that occurs outside of red blood cells, typically in the liver.
    • Researchers are studying exoerythrocytic development to find new drug targets.
    • During the exoerythrocytic cycle, the parasite multiplies before entering the bloodstream.
    • The exoerythrocytic stage of the malaria parasite takes place in the liver cells.
